#d93b10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d93b10 is composed of 85.1% red, 23.1%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 92.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 12.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 45.7%. #d93b10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7620 with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d93b10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d93b10 has RGB values of R:217, G:59,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.93,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14236432.

Shades and Tints of #d93b10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100401 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d93b10
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767373 is the less saturated color, while #e23607 is the most saturated one.
